Celtic manager Neil Lennon revealed Hatem Elhamed is set to return to former club Hapoel Be’er Sheva after being left “very low” with life in Scotland. The 29-year-old defender, who was signed from the Israeli club for a reported £1.6million in 2019, has made one substitute appearance since early December.

After the 2-1 home win over Motherwell at Celtic Park, Lennon said: “A deal’s been agreed with Be’er Sheva. I don’t know if it has been finalised.
